    Hi eddien4 and welcome.

     

    No this is not normal.  Have you run a full anti-virus scan?

     

    Unfortunately, this problem can be caused by lots of things and can depend on what software has been installed.

     

    The most usual cause, other than a virus infection, is that the Vaio is searching for links to software, services or drivers that no longer exist, have been moved or not fully uninstalled.

     

    A software/driver conflict is another possibility as is a heavily fragmented hard drive or the system paging large amounts of data to the hard drive.

     

    Two suggestions: -

     

    1. Download a 30 day free trial of a Registry cleaning program to remove any incomplete or broken links.  Run the utility to remove junk files.  I would leave the hard drive defragmentation for now as this may take a long time to run on such a large hard disc.  I am reluctant to recommend software of this sort as it can occasionally cause problems but I use System Mechanic.

     

    http://www.iolo.com/system-mechanic/standard/download.aspx

     

    Alternatively, try a lightweight, free cleaner like CCleaner: -

     

    http://www.filehippo.com/download_ccleaner/

     

    2.Back up the files and data on the Vaio and restore the system back to factory settings using the Recovery Guide here: -

     

    ftp://ftp.vaio-link.com/pub/manuals/consumer/2011Q3_TRG_EN.pdf

     

    You will have to set it up again from new but this gives you an opportunity to load software one at a time and see if one particular program is causing the issue.
